Ascension : Vacancy - Deck Rating Trainee RMS St Helena
Submitted by The Islander (Islander Editors) 27.01.2011 (Article Archived on 10.02.2011)

Carrying out assigned tasks during berthing / unberthing / anchoring

Deck Rating Trainee

RMS St Helena

 

Main Duties:

 

  • Carrying out assigned tasks during berthing / unberthing / anchoring
  • Carrying out deck repairs and maintenance duties as directed by the bosun, including cleaning of cargo spaces, external decks and deck stores.
  • Strictly observing on board safety regulations and being aware of the location and method of use of all lifesaving, emergency and safety equipment.
  • Handling and stowing all ship’s stores and spare gear.
  • Preparing the vessel for sea as directed by the bosun, including securing of cargo / containers when required
  • Participating in shipboard training programme.

 

Requirement:

 

  • Education to GCSE Level or equivalent
